Texas Ent Conroe TX: A Comprehensive Guide

Conroe, Texas, is a vibrant city located in the heart of the Lone Star State. Known for its rich history, beautiful landscapes, and thriving economy, Conroe offers a unique blend of small-town charm and big-city amenities. If you’re considering a move to Conroe or simply want to learn more about this wonderful community, this detailed guide will provide you with all the information you need.

Geography and Climate

Conroe is situated in Montgomery County, Texas, and is approximately 40 miles north of Houston. The city covers an area of about 35 square miles and has a population of over 100,000 residents. The region boasts a humid subtropical climate, with hot summers and mild winters. The average temperature in July, the hottest month, is around 95掳F, while January, the coldest month, averages about 50掳F.

Education

Conroe is home to several excellent educational institutions, including Conroe Independent School District (CISD). CISD serves over 30,000 students and offers a wide range of academic, extracurricular, and athletic programs. The district is committed to providing a high-quality education and preparing students for success in the future.

Conroe also has several private schools, including The Woodlands Christian Academy and The Classical Academy of Conroe. Additionally, Lone Star College-Conroe Center offers a variety of associate degrees, certificates, and continuing education courses.

Employment and Economy

Conroe’s economy is diverse and robust, with a strong focus on healthcare, retail, and manufacturing. The city is home to several major employers, including Memorial Hermann The Woodlands Hospital, The Woodlands Mall, and Conroe Regional Medical Center. The region also has a growing technology sector, with several tech companies establishing a presence in the area.

Conroe’s location near Houston makes it an attractive destination for businesses looking to expand or relocate. The city offers a skilled workforce, affordable real estate, and a business-friendly environment.
